It was 1957 when Harry Hoesnselaar opened the
first HoneyBaked Ham Company store in Detroit,
Michigan. He'd select only the
finest-quality bone-in hams, cure them in a secret marinade, and smoke them for
hours over a blend of hardwood chips. From there, Harry coated each ham in his
signature crispy-sweet glaze. He even invented a machine that can slice a ham
in one long, continuous spiral.
Three generations and over 400 stores later, the Hoenselaar family still
prepares HoneyBaked Ham the same way Harry did-with care, craft, and commitment
to quality that make this ham worthy of the title "World's Best".
